Because the world takes a step away from in-office working conditions, the completion of paperwork increasingly occurs online. The i have been retained by concerning the monies owed by you form isn’t an exception. Working with it using digital tools differs from doing so in the physical world.
An eDocument can be considered legally binding on condition that certain needs are fulfilled. They are especially crucial when it comes to signatures and stipulations related to them. Entering your initials or full name alone will not guarantee that the institution requesting the form or a court would consider it accomplished. You need a reliable tool, like airSlate SignNow that provides a signer with a digital certificate. In addition to that, airSlate SignNow keeps compliance with ESIGN, UETA, and eIDAS - key legal frameworks for eSignatures.
